Anushka, Sonakshi opposite Rajini in K.S. Ravikumar film?

Even as superstar Rajinikanth’s Kochadaiiyaan, the first-ever 3-D animation film in the country, gets ready to hit the screens next week all over the world, reports have started trickling in as to what could be his next film. It is said that K.S. Ravikumar, who has had a very successful association with Rajini for the past two decades, would be directing Rajini’s next film.

Though Rajini hasn’t officially announced anything about it, sources close to K.S. Ravikumar assure on condition of anonymity that it would be Ravikumar who would be directing the film. Anushka and Bollywood’s Sonakshi Sinha are to be Rajini’s two heroines in the film as Rajini is to portray dual roles in the film, it is further informed.

Ravikumar’s Muthu and Padaiyappa, which featured Rajini and released in the nineties, were colossal hits and had Rajini essaying dual roles. Sentimentally, K.S. Ravikumar wants to maintain the trend of dual roles by Rajini and has accordingly prepared his script which Rajini has approved. A.R. Rahman would be scoring the film’s music which would have all its lyrics penned by Vairamuthu.



Cinamatographer R. Rathnavelu, who had done a phenomenal work in Rajinii’s super-duper hit Enthiran: The Robot and who is fondly referred to as ‘Randy’ by Rajini, would be the cinematographer of this as-yet-untitled venture. The film is likely to go to the floors in Chennai with a formal muhurat on 20th May. The following day, Rajini and the rest of the crew members would leave for Mysore.
